Renovation of an educational facility in San Mateo, California. Completed plans call for the renovation of a educational facility.

The project consists of the following scope of work as indicated: Bid Package #5 - Laurel Elementary School and Abbott Middle School As per specified locations and construction specifications provided by the District, the project consists of all labor, materials, equipment and services necessary to complete the following scope: Move all furniture in and out of rooms during pre/post construction, provide wall protection Demo and remove the existing carpet, VCT/LVT, sheet vinyl, and wall base In Modular Classrooms, furnish and install new wood underlayment in all areas receiving new flooring as per manufacturer specifications (At Laurel Elementary and Abbott Middle School - Portables Only) Underlayment to be used is - 9 mm (3/8") premium underlayment (7 ply construction) - by Powerhold. (no underlayment less than 9 mm (3/8") - 7 ply construction is permitted to be used in modular classrooms) Furnish and Install new specified entry walk off carpet tile, field carpet tile, resilient plank flooring, resilient sheet flooring, top set coved wall base and all related sundries and accessories. Pre-qualification for all bidding General Contractors and Sub-Contractors is to be through Quality Bidders at www.qualitybidders.com In addition, if the Project has flooring, electrical, mechanical, or plumbing components that will be performed by subcontractors performing under the following license classification (s), C-4, C-7, C-10, C-15, C-16, C-20, C-34, C-36, C-38, C-42, C-43, and/or C-46. then each of those subcontractors that intend to bid as a first-tier subcontractor to a general contractor (prime contractor) are required to have been prequalified by the District Any claim by a bidder of error in its bid must be made in compliance with section 5100 et seq. of the Public Contract Code. Any bid that is submitted after this time shall be non-responsive and returned to the bidder. As security for its Bid, each bidder shall provide with its Bid form a bid bond issued by an admitted surety insurer on the form provided by the District, cash, or a cashier's check or a certified check, drawn to the order of the San Mateo-Foster City School District in the amount of ten percent (10%) of the total bid price. This bid security shall be a guarantee that the Bidder shall, within seven (7) calendar days after the date of the Notice of Award, enter into a contract with the District for the performance of the services as stipulated in the bid. The successful Bidder shall be required to furnish a 100% Performance Bond and a 100% Payment Bond if it is awarded the contract for the Project.
